Summary: Failed to access file due to locked access when using
more than one Maven worker thread

My multi-module POM contains of ten modules. Each of that modules does the
same: Invoke the 'copy' goal of the dependency plugin. The idea is to have ten
copies of the identical source, which then will end up in ten different targets
by getting furthere processed.
As long as I do not use more than one Maven worker thread, everything works
well always. But when using -T 5 to have five worker threads, rather often the
reactor fails because the source file (!) is locked:
[ERROR] Failed to execute goal
org.apache.maven.plugins:maven-dependency-plugin:2.8:copy (copy) on project
MYARTIFACT: Unable to resolve artifact. Could not transfer artifact
mygroup:myartifact:dll:4.36.1-20140415.143537-37 from/to nexus
(http://nexus/nexus/content/groups/public):
C:\Users\jenkins.QUIPSY\.m2\repository\mygroup\myartifact\4.36.1-SNAPSHOT\myartifact-4.36.1-20140415.143537-37.dll
(The process cannot access the file, because it is in use by another process)
So it seems that the 'copy' task actually is locking the source file, which is
not multi-threading-compatible. Hence, either that is a bug and should get
fixed, or it is on purpose, then this goal has to be marked as
non-multithreading-able.
